Post by pimaster on Dec 2, 2008 16:23:58 GMT -5
I've posted a couple more pictures to BGG (see link above). They show a comparison between the GenCon preorders and the production versions.
One thing I've noticed is that they reduced the size of the planets and markers in the production version. The GenCon version of the markers is 13/16" wide (side to side), while the production markers are 11/16" wide. The Jupiter marker has also shrunk from 2 1/16" x 3 2/16" to 1 15/16" x 3".
